MUMBAI: Digital imaging company, Canon India, has signed up Anushka Sharma as the youth icon to mark the re-positioning of the PowerShot sub-brand.

The company is introducing the new series of PowerShot Digital Cameras which target youth between the age group of 18-30 years of age.

The new PowerShot range enters the lifestyle offerings and the existing IXUS range of lifestyle cameras. It is now focused on the distinctly ‘premium’ consumers whose accessories define their luxury statement to differentiate from others.

Canon India SVP Alok Bharadwaj said, “Canon is an aspirational brand and so is the attractiveness and energetic persona of Anushka Sharma who the audience looks up to as the youth icon. Canon has evolved significantly and securing a youth icon is a conscious step in the natural progression to take our brand to the next level in an increasingly competitive market.”

The company is rolling out a campaign with Sharma called ‘What makes us Click’. Through the campaign, PowerShot aims at connecting the whole new concept of image capturing with the youth. The company is not focusing on any specific feature or product in the category, but on the brand PowerShot as a whole.

The campaign is supported by a national print campaign as well as TV commercials during the peak travel season of April and May.

Additionally, Canon is also launching a new IXUS series campaign featuring the Indian model – Indrani Dasgupta on the theme ‘Live It Up with IXUS’. The aim of this print campaign is to enhance the style and luxury quotient of the existing IXUS range, making it a strong premium range for segment that demands efficiency, portability, easy usability and luxury.

Both the campaigns are targeted at the young working population with differing buying drivers.

Canon also recently announced a new range of consumer digital imaging products to embrace next generation technologies and be the first to revolutionize in terms of product innovation and technology. The launch included IXUS 510 HS, IXUS 240 HS incorporated with Wi-Fi sharing.

The new line-up includes 10 new models – 6 PowerShot A series, 2 PowerShot SX series and 2 IXUS series models. This is in addition to three models ( 2 IXUS AND 1 G series ) already announced earlier this year. Some of the advanced features include HS System with new DIGIC 5 image processor, Advanced Face ID – the smartest Smart Auto yet, New Canon lenses – giving the sensor new eyes, Advanced Movie Shooting Functions and Intelligent IS and Optical IS.
